Full Description

Show more
The project consists of the development of a two-story, 45,000 square foot outdoor amusement center venue consisting of a multi-level golf driving range, full service restaurant and bar, event spaces, and 350 parking stalls on an approximately 14.5-acre site in the Office Building Low Rise Mixed-Use (OB-PUD) zone and Gateway Planned Unit Development (PUD). The main structure would feature 80 golf bays split between two climate-controlled levels with customers hitting balls into an approximately 190,000 square foot outfield area. Entitlements include: a Conditional Use Permit (CUP) to authorize an amusement center, outdoor use on 14.5 acres in the OB-PUD zone; Site Plan and Design Review (SPDR) for construction of the 2-story outdoor amusement center venue, driving range, and associated site improvements with deviations to fencing standards; and a Tree Permit for the removal of eight private-protected trees; and a PUD Schematic Plan and Development Guidelines Amendment to designate the site for an amusement center, outdoor use and to amend the permitted uses, development standards, and sign code criteria for amusement center, outdoor uses in the OB-PUD zone.

Eagle Reserve Golf Course Full-Service Golf Course Management
Solicitation # TAMUT-RFP-2019_082026
Texas A&M University–Texarkana has acquired Eagle Reserve, an 18-hole golf course renowned for its dramatic elevation changes and scenic views of Bringle Lake, directly across from campus, and now seeks a qualified management firm to operate the property as a self-sustaining, premier college amenity and regional golf destination. The university intends for the course to serve students, faculty, alumni, local residents, and visiting golfers while aligning with broader institutional goals in athletics, alumni relations, student life, and recruitment, with a focus on financial sustainability and long-term growth. The selected provider will be responsible for comprehensive operational management, including golf shop operations, course maintenance, food and beverage services, administrative and bookkeeping functions, and marketing initiatives to ensure a high-quality experience and increased patronage. The solicitation, titled Eagle Reserve Golf Course Full-Service Golf Course Management under solicitation number TAMUT-RFP-2019_082026, was posted on August 7, 2026, with responses due by September 1, 2026. The opportunity is open to qualified firms through the Texas SmartBuy platform, with no set-aside requirements specified. Point of contact for inquiries is Kristen Tullos, who can be reached via phone at 903-223-3053 or email at ktullos@tamut.edu. The property is located in Texas, and all operations are expected to be conducted on-site to support TAMUT’s vision of transforming Eagle Reserve into a thriving, integrated campus asset that enhances both the university community and the wider regional golf market.

Golf Course Operations, Management & Maintenance Services
Solicitation # RFP 2026-005
The City of Alamogordo, through its Parks and Recreation Administration, is seeking proposals to manage, operate, and maintain Desert Lakes Golf Course, an 18-hole public facility located at the base of the Sacramento Mountains. The course features a unique blend of tree-lined parkland on the front nine and arid desert terrain on the back nine, with native vegetation, bunkers, and panoramic mountain views, accommodating golfers of all skill levels across four sets of tees totaling up to 6,811 yards. The facility includes a pro shop, practice areas, golf cart rentals, and the 19th Hole Grill and Bar, and operates year-round thanks to the region’s mild climate. The contract will cover comprehensive operations, maintenance, customer service, tournament management, instructional programming, and daily upkeep to ensure the course remains a vibrant public asset for residents and visitors. Proposals must be submitted by August 26, 2026, in response to solicitation RFP 2026-005, posted on July 30, 2026. The procurement is managed by the City of Alamogordo’s Procurement Specialist, Vivian Pedone, who can be contacted via phone or email for inquiries. The place of performance is specifically the Desert Lakes Golf Course in Alamogordo, New Mexico, with no set-aside provisions indicated. The city aims to secure a qualified operator capable of delivering high-quality recreational services while preserving the course’s distinctive character and ensuring its long-term sustainability as a municipally owned facility.

Admiral Baker Golf Course Renovation Project
Solicitation # NAVMWR-26-R-0047
The Admiral Baker Golf Course Renovation Project at Naval Base San Diego is a design-build initiative aimed at fully modernizing the existing 18-hole course to deliver a safe, accessible, and commercially competitive recreation destination for military personnel and base patrons. The scope encompasses comprehensive site development, demolition, and site preparation to replace aging utilities and upgrade water resource systems, addressing longstanding drainage problems and enhancing operational efficiency for MWR staff. The renovation will reconfigure the entire landscape to optimize playability and reduce safety hazards, while restoration efforts will ensure environmental compliance and long-term sustainability. Government-furnished materials will be integrated as part of the work, ensuring alignment with military standards and infrastructure requirements. This solicitation, numbered NAVMWR-26-R-0047, was posted on July 30, 2026, with responses due by August 28, 2026, and is managed by the Commander Navy Installations Command under NAICS code 713910 for recreational facilities. The project has no set aside and is open to all eligible contractors. Performance will take place in San Diego, California, while contract administration is handled from Millington, Tennessee. Primary point of contact is A’Keesha Stark, Contracting Officer, with Kylie M. de La Bruyere serving as Contract Specialist. All proposals must adhere to the detailed requirements outlined in the RFP to ensure successful execution of the transformational upgrade to this critical recreational asset.

Lloydminster Golf Course Operator Services
Solicitation # LGCCRFP-2026-01
The City of Lloydminster is inviting qualified proponents to submit proposals for the operation and management of all golf-related services at the Lloydminster Golf and Curling Centre under solicitation LGCCRFP-2026-01. The selected vendor will serve as the primary customer-facing operator responsible for delivering a full range of services including pro shop retail, golf instruction, cart and back shop maintenance, tournament and event coordination, league programming, food and beverage operations both in the restaurant and via on-course beverage carts, and overall guest experience management. The role requires a demonstrated commitment to enhancing participation, retaining customers, and driving profitability through high-quality service, professional leadership, and innovative programming that appeals to all demographics with a specific focus on growing the game among youth and new participants. Proposals are due by September 9, 2026, and the solicitation was posted on July 16, 2026. The vendor will be expected to maintain a welcoming, professional environment that aligns with the City’s goals for community engagement and facility sustainability. The point of contact for inquiries is Jordan Newton, reachable by phone at 780-874-3700 or email at jnewton@lloydminster.ca. This contract opportunity is open to experienced golf operations providers with a track record of successful facility management, revenue generation, and community-based program development within a public sector setting in Saskatchewan.
